Surge protector installation services involve setting up specialized devices designed to shield electrical systems and appliances from unexpected power surges. These services typically include assessing the property's electrical setup, selecting the appropriate surge protection equipment, and professionally installing the devices to ensure optimal performance. Proper installation is essential for safeguarding sensitive electronics, appliances, and entire electrical panels from voltage spikes caused by lightning strikes, power outages, or grid fluctuations.
This service helps address common electrical problems associated with power surges, such as damaged appliances, data loss, and increased risk of electrical fires. Power surges can occur unexpectedly and may cause significant harm to electronic devices or electrical wiring if not properly managed. Surge protector installation provides a reliable barrier against these sudden voltage increases, helping to prevent costly repairs and minimize the inconvenience of equipment failures.
Properties that often benefit from surge protector installation include residential homes, especially those with valuable electronics, home offices, or smart home systems. Commercial buildings, retail stores, and small businesses also frequently use surge protection to safeguard computers, point-of-sale systems, and other sensitive equipment. Even multi-unit dwellings or properties with outdoor electrical equipment can benefit from professional surge protection to ensure consistent and safe operation of electrical systems.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or surge protector installations usually range from $100 to $300.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the complexity of the setup and local rates.
Standard Installations - For standard surge protector upgrades or replacements, local contractors often charge between $250 and $600. Larger, more involved projects can reach $1,000 or more, but these are less common for basic jobs.
Full System Upgrades - Complete electrical panel upgrades with integrated surge protection typically cost from $1,500 to $3,500. These larger projects are less frequent and often involve additional wiring or electrical work.
Complex or Commercial Projects - Larger, more complex surge protection installations for commercial or multi-unit properties can exceed $5,000, depending on the scale and specific requirements. Such projects are less common and usually involve extensive planning and equipment.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are surge protectors used for? Surge protectors are designed to prevent electrical damage to devices by blocking or limiting voltage spikes caused by power surges.
Why should I consider professional surge protector installation? Professional installation ensures the surge protector is correctly wired and positioned for optimal protection of your electrical system and connected devices.
How do local contractors install surge protectors? Local service providers typically mount surge protectors at the main electrical panel or specific outlets, ensuring proper grounding and connection for effective performance.
Are there different types of surge protectors available? Yes, options include whole-house surge protectors, point-of-use devices, and combination systems, each suited for different protection needs.
